Abstract

The present study research investigated relations between the performance in the solution of problems and exercises about fractions and variables such as: the attitudes in relation to mathematics, the attitudes in relation to fractions, the genre and the grade. 95 students of High School from a public school participated in the research. The instruments used were: scale of attitudes in relation to mathematics and in relation to fractions and three mathematical test: of algorithm, of conceptual and involving problems. The results indicated that the strongest correlations were between the marks in the test of algorithm and of the, between the scales of attitudes in relation to mathematics and in relation to fraction and in smaller degree, between the mark of the problems and the scale of fractions. In relation to the genre, no significant differences were found. Also, it was observed that the general performance tends to increase according to the grade, in contrast of what happens to the attitudes in relation to mathematics.
